This folder contains a repaint for the A2A WoP3 P-51D Mustang (with AccuSim), in the colors of P-51D-10-NA 44-14060 5Q-A “FABASCA V†as flown by Maj. Bill C Routt of Nacogdoches TX, 504th FS/ 339th FG . FABASCA stood for “Fast As a Bullet And Slick as a Cat’s Arseâ€. Maj. Routt had at least five known FABASCA’s starting with P-51B 42-106838 5Q-A. #5 was written off in a crash-landing on 20 February 1945 with Capt. Arlen W Wells at the controls. This folder contains a repaint for the A2A WoP3 P-51D Mustang, in the colors of P-51D-10-NA 44-14771 YJ-L "Willit Run?" which flew with the 351st FS, 353rd FG from Raydon in the UK, with Maj Frederick LeFebre as its regular pilot. The P-51 is named “Willit Run?â€, but the nose art on this plane is not talking about this particular aircraft or any P-51 for that matter. It’s an inside joke of WWII vintage.
During WWII, as in every big war, private industry is called upon to produce war goods rather than civilian goods – “guns vs. butterâ€. Henry Ford took on a huge project to contract-build Consolidated B-24 Liberator bombers in a new state-of-the-art manufacturing facility to be built on a farm which Henry Ford owned at Willow Run near Detroit. The facility was to be a prime example of Roosevelt’s “Arsenal of Democracyâ€, conceived and built on an unprecedented scale. Begun in April, 1941, it was the largest enclosed room in the world, with 3.5 million square feet. But Willow Run had a long and troubled construction and start-up time. So long and troubled a start-up, that after two years with little results the public became disillusioned with the project and derisively nicknamed the plant “Willit Run?â€.
Ford persevered however, and Willow Run finally hit its stride, eventually producing at the prodigious rate of 650 B-24 bombers per month by August, 1944. At war’s end, Willow Run had produced about half of the 18,000 B-24's which saw service in the war.

This folder contains a repaint for the A2A WoP3 P-51D Mustang, in the colors of P-51D-15-NA 44-1587 SX-U "Stasia II", which was assigned to Capt Anthony R Rosatone of the 352nd FS/ 353rd FG, based in Raydon UK.Capt. Rosatone was lost in this aircraft on 18 January 1945 during the Ardennes offensive. The crash site has never been found and Capt. Rosatone is therefore still officially MIA.

This folder contains a repaint for the A2A WoP3 P-51D Mustang, in the colors of P-51D-10-NA 44-14804 first named “El Gato†by Capt. Maurice Morrison and later “Honey Bee II†by Lt. Harold Miller. This was the only P-51 to fly as SX-R between October 1944 and the end of the war. It logged 84 missions with 32 different pilots (31 with Morrison and 5 with Miller). Morrison named the aircraft “El Gato†(Spanish for The Cat) after returning eight times either badly shot up or after another worrying experience. When he was assigned a P-51 he felt he was on his ninth life. Repaint by Jan Kees Blom, based on the paintkit by A2A.
